The MBR membrane price in India varies widely depending on membrane material, module capacity, brand, configuration, application, and order quantity. A basic replacement module may have a very different price from a complete MBR skid designed for industrial wastewater reuse. Many buyers make the mistake of comparing only the purchase price per module. In practice, the real cost includes membrane area, installation, aeration, energy consumption, chemical cleaning, maintenance, spare parts, downtime, and eventual replacement. A proper price evaluation should therefore consider both initial investment and total cost of ownership.

What Determines MBR Membrane Price?
Membrane material
The polymer is one of the key price factors. PVDF membranes are widely used in MBR systems because they provide good mechanical and chemical resistance. PTFE membranes may command a higher price because of their material properties and manufacturing complexity.
The membrane material should be selected according to wastewater characteristics, not simply according to the lowest quotation. Wastewater containing solvents, oils, high temperatures, or aggressive chemicals may require a more robust membrane.
Hollow fibre or flat sheet
MBR membranes are generally available in hollow-fibre or flat-sheet configurations.

| Factor | Hollow-fibre membrane | Flat-sheet membrane |
| Typical strength | High membrane area per module | Robust individual plates |
| Footprint | Compact | May require more space |
| Cleaning | Requires suitable air scouring and backwashing | Often mechanically accessible |
| Replacement | Module-based replacement | Cassette or plate replacement |
| Price | Depends on fibre design and packing density | Depends on plate size and construction |
The price difference is influenced by membrane area, module design, support structure, potting quality, and aeration requirements.
Membrane area and Capacity
MBR membranes are normally sized according to required permeate flow and design flux. A plant requiring 100 cubic metres per day will need significantly less membrane area than a plant treating 1,000 cubic metres per day.

However, design flux should not be maximised without considering fouling risk. A higher flux may reduce membrane area but can increase cleaning frequency, energy use, and the possibility of irreversible fouling.
Brand and technology Origin
Imported brands may carry higher prices because of:
- International manufacturing costs.
- Freight and insurance.
- Customs duties and taxes.
- Currency fluctuations.
- Distributor margins.
- Overseas technical support.
- Longer replacement logistics.
An Indian MBR Membrane may offer lower landed cost and faster availability. However, purchasers should verify performance data, service support, and compatibility before making a decision.
Replacement Compatibility
Retrofit membranes designed to replace existing modules may involve engineering, adapters, header modifications, or changes to aeration systems. A direct replacement may cost more than a standard module but can reduce civil modifications and plant downtime.
Some Indian suppliers offer retrofit membranes intended to replace established imported modules. A supplier listing for a retrofit hollow-fibre module, for example, describes local availability and cost-effectiveness as key benefits.
Indicative Price Ranges
Publicly listed prices should be treated only as preliminary indicators. A supplier’s final quotation may change after reviewing wastewater data, flow, membrane area, module dimensions, and delivery terms.
Some market listings show individual membrane-related products ranging from a few thousand rupees to approximately ₹25,000 per unit, depending on product type and specification. Other supplier-published international comparisons quote membrane costs by square metre, with premium imported products often priced above locally manufactured alternatives.
These figures are not universal price benchmarks. Buyers should request a project-specific quotation that clearly states:
- Price per module.
- Membrane area per module.
- Number of modules required.
- GST and freight.
- Installation and commissioning.
- Warranty.
- Spare modules.
- Cleaning chemicals.
- Technical support.
- Delivery schedule.
Initial Cost Versus Lifecycle Cost
The cheapest membrane may not be the most economical solution. A membrane with lower initial cost may require higher aeration, more frequent cleaning, or earlier replacement.
Lifecycle cost includes:
- Capital cost.
- Energy consumption.
- Membrane cleaning.
- Replacement frequency.
- Labour and maintenance.
- Sludge disposal.
- Production downtime.
- Performance losses caused by fouling.
- Technical service charges.
For example, a membrane that costs 15% more but lasts 30% longer and requires less cleaning may deliver a lower total cost over five years.
How to Reduce MBR Membrane Cost
Improve pretreatment
Fine screening, grit removal, oil separation, and equalisation help protect the membrane. Poor pretreatment allows hair, fibres, plastics, oil, and large particles to enter the MBR tank and increase fouling.
Select realistic flux
Designing at an unnecessarily high flux can increase fouling and cleaning requirements. A conservative flux often improves stability and membrane life.
Compare local and imported options
Request quotations from both an Indian MBR Membrane Supplier and authorised imported-brand distributors. Compare equivalent membrane area and technical performance rather than comparing only unit prices.
Plan for spares
Maintaining critical spares reduces production risk. The buyer should assess whether the supplier can provide urgent replacement modules and maintain inventory in India.
Evaluate the complete package
A membrane supplier offering engineering, commissioning, optimisation, and after-sales service may provide better long-term value than a vendor selling only the membrane module.
